  • Dynamic Link issues between Pr and Ae

    Hey Guys -
    We have had issues with our dynamic link since the last update to Premiere CC 45 days ago. Two different iMacs, one 2010 and the other late 2012 are both having these issues. Regardless of system, we weren't having the issue before the most recent update.
    The issue we are having is as follows:
    If we create a composition in Ae and bring it into Pr using dynamic link, it's completely fine, you can see it in the Source window as you should. But as soon as we drop it on the timeline in a sequence, it requires us to render both in Pr and back in Ae before it will display in the sequence. And ironically, you don't have to render the exact dynamic linked composition back in Ae, but any old render of any of your compositions will then allow you push through the stumbling render in Pr and so you can display the composition on the Pr timeline.
    The problem furthers when you begin to edit again and have to redo the entire rendering process if you make one move anywhere on your timeline. We've found this renders dynamic link useless as it's more time effective to just render out the composition in Ae everytime you make a change than have to deal with these troubles. Really frustrating as we love DL and used it constantly before the most recent Pr update.
    And as an FYI, we are not doing big effects, these are simple lower thirds and titles that we are doing here. Very little processing power required.
    Is there any fix in the works or is anyone else struggling with this? Seems too ironic that two separate systems are dealing with the same issue...

    I had the same issue with dynamic link...the files would become unlinked and required a manual re-linking of each clip.  Mostly happened with MXF media from my Panasonic P2 camera, Here is a workaround that so far has worked:
    1. Use Raylight (I use this software all the time when I edit with fcp 7) to create a QT reference file from MXF media.  It's super quick too...takes about 15 seconds to generate the aliases from a 64 GB card with tons of clips.
    2. Import these QT ref files into PP CC and edit like normal.  It seems to trick the software into thinking you are working with .MOV files and not MXF media which seem to be problematic in Premiere/After Effects.
    Hope this helps....

  • Dynamic report issue

    Dears, I'm back again
    I have and issue with my dynamic report:
    My source:
    DECLARE
    vTABLE VARCHAR2(100);
    vCOLUMN VARCHAR2(100);
    vVALUE varchar2(100);
    vSQL VARCHAR2(1000);
    BEGIN
    vTABLE := :P46_TABLELIST;
    vCOLUMN:=:P46_COLUMNLIST;
    vVALUE:=:P46_COLVALUE;
         vSQL := 'SELECT '||vCOLUMN || ' FROM ' || vTABLE || 'WHERE '|| vCOLUMN ||'='||vVALUE||;
    RETURN vSQL;
    END;
    And it doesn't work fine.
    When I run it in SQL workshop i have this error :
    ORA-06550: line 11, column 88:
    PLS-00103: Encountered the symbol ";" when expecting one of the following:
    ( - + case mod new null
    avg
    count current max min prior sql stddev sum variance execute
    forall merge time timestamp interval date
    pipe
    1. DECLARE
    2. vTABLE VARCHAR2(100);
    3. vCOLUMN VARCHAR2(100);
    hx for your help
    Celio

    Celio, first you have to build function on database
    CREATE OR REPLACE FUNCTION your_function
    RETURN VARCHAR2
    IS
    vSQL varchar2(4000);
    BEGIN
    vSQL := 'SELECT '||v('P46_COLUMNLIST') || ' FROM ' ||v('P46_TABLELIST') || ' WHERE '||v('P46_COLUMNLIST') ||'='||v('P46_COLVALUE');
    RETURN vSQL;
    end;
    Second
    You have to run function in SQL region
    RETURN your_function;
    And last
    You have to check "Use Generic Column Names (parse query at runtime only)" radio and set number of column for example 1.
